Heart Egg Hole Toast

Heart Egg Hole Toast: A Charming Breakfast Delight


  • Author: Jannet Lisa
  • Total Time: 10 minutes
  • Yield: 2 servings 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

Heart Egg-in-a-Hole Toast is a charming and simple breakfast made with a golden egg cooked inside a heart-shaped slice of bread.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 slices of sandwich bread (white, wheat, or sourdough)
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 tablespoon unsalted butter or olive oil
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• Shredded cheese
  • Fresh herbs (parsley or chives)
  • Chili flakes
  • Avocado slices
  • Fresh berries or sliced fruit
  • Jam or preserves

Instructions

  1. Use a heart-shaped cookie cutter to cut the center out of each slice of bread. Save the cut-outs.
  2. Melt butter in a nonstick skillet over medium heat. Add the bread slices.
  3. Crack one egg into each heart-shaped hole. Season with salt and pepper. Cook 2–3 minutes until whites are mostly set.
  4. Carefully flip and cook another 1–2 minutes until desired yolk doneness.
  5. Toast the heart-shaped bread pieces until golden.
  6. Plate the toast and cut-outs, garnish with optional toppings, and serve immediately.
